Bite-Sized History: Cinema Meets Vaudeville

In the sixth chapter in our Bite-Sized History series, cinema and vaudeville compete (and co-exist), there’s a theater boom in Portsmouth, and The Music Hall sees the tide come in and go out on its popularity.
